You're welcome.  Bottom line, at least feed the preset machine two images at the extrema of what your auto ISO range is (to avoid clamping of the sliders in the preset at the highest specified ISO).  Better yet, if you find that the interpolated slider values are not exactly right, fill in with some additional ISOs and slider settings that work better for your camera.  Then you can steer the interpolation in the direction you want.
